> It's Recipes from the Wagstaff Miscellany "which is a collection of recipes, poems, and other texts written sometime in the fifteenth century. This book contains a transcription of the 189 culinary recipes from the  miscellany in the original Middle English, along with notes and related recipes from other contemporary sources." This is also known as the Beinecke MS 163 which is held by Yale University. We dated it as circa 1460 for the Concordance of English Recipes.
> 
> The author of this volume is Dan Myers of MedievalCookery.com and http://medievalcookery.blogspot.com. Or Master 
> Edouard Halidai of this list. Often posting as Doc.
> 
> The text is pretty much what he has been posting about, but now it's in print form. Easy to order through Amazon.
> 
> Highly recommended.
